PARKER, Dorothy Louisa Ennis Parker Passed away peacefully December 29, 2019, at the Care Home of Fort Langley Seniors Community. She was eighty-nine years old. She is survived by; her children; Roger (Hazel) and Karen (Tony), her grandchildren Andrew and Heather (Clay), and great-grandchild James Joseph, and many other extended family in both Canada and Ireland. She was predeceased by her husband Joseph in 2018, her son Stephen 1975, and her siblings Freddy and Phyllis. A Funeral Service will be held at St. George's Anglican Church, in Fort Langley, on Monday, (January 6) at 2.00 p.m. Followed by private Cremation and then interment of ashes in Ireland. The family wishes to thank St. George's, Rev. Kelly Duncan and the nursing staff at the Care Home for their compassionate care. No flowers.
